Transaction 97620c163e78074a50e15d191e62cfce642092a7dd80ee54ddfb15d83ac1c155
1 Input
1 Output
-
97620c163e78074a50e15d191e62cfce642092a7dd80ee54ddfb15d83ac1c155:0
- value
- 2616989
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0deb941e898a89e836bf8d6576491e5c6013e0b6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12GbznK8QwAKGE3WgjrW9pL6cpXkf2gi25